维度建模的命名标准

vik*_*ikc 4 data-warehouse dimensional-modeling

我正在使用Kimball的方法为数据仓库项目进行第一次维度建模任务.当我准备我的模型并考虑物理对象时,我想知道数据库对象的推荐命名方案是什么.我们将使用Oracle,目前我们还没有任何标准.任何帮助,将不胜感激.

Vic*_*HDC 6

您可以从Oracle BI应用程序数据模型中获取一些想法.登录Oracle支持帐户并查找以下文档:Oracle业务分析仓库数据模型参考版本7.9.6.3(文档ID 1325948.1)

以下是一些命名约定:

字首

W_ =仓库

后缀

_A =聚合

_D =尺寸

_DH =维度层次结构

_DHS =维度层次结构的暂存

_DS =维度的暂存

_F =事实

_FS =事实的分期

_H =帮手

_MD =迷你尺寸

_TMP =预暂存临时表

例如:Sales Fact表是W_Sales_F

来自西北大学的这份文件提供了有关命名列的有用提示,例如使用素数,限定词和类词(例如STUDENT_FIRST_NAME)

kimball group的设计提示#71包含命名约定的一般准则

例如,销售分析师会对销售数字感兴趣,但事实证明,此销售数字实际上是Sales_Commissionable_Amount,与Sales_Gross_Amount和Sales_Net_Amount不同.